What Is Machine Learning?
Machine Learning is a branch of Artificial Intelligence that allows computers to learn from
data and improve their performance without being programmed with every possible
instruction. Instead of simply following fixed commands, machine learning models study
information, identify patterns, and use those patterns to produce predictions or useful results.
How Machine Learning Works
It generally starts with data. The system studies a collection of information and looks for
patterns or relationships within it. Algorithms are then used to build a model that can make
predictions when it receives new information.

Machine Learning in Everyday Life
This is already influencing everyday activities in many ways. When a streaming platform
recommends a movie or song, machine learning may analyze previous viewing or listening
behavior to provide personalized suggestions. Online shopping platforms can recommend
products based on searches, purchases, and browsing patterns.
Smartphones also use machine learning for facial recognition, camera improvements, voice
recognition, security features, and personalized recommendations. Navigation applications
can analyze traffic patterns and provide route suggestions. Email services can identify
unwanted messages and separate them from important communication.
Machine Learning in Business
Businesses are increasingly using machine learning to improve productivity, understand
customers, and make data-driven decisions. Companies can analyze large datasets to discover
market trends, predict customer behavior, forecast product demand, identify suspicious
transactions, and personalize marketing campaigns.
It can also automate repetitive tasks. This allows employees to spend more time on creative
thinking, communication, strategy, and problem-solving. When used correctly, machine
learning can help organizations save time, reduce manual effort, and create better customer
experiences.
Machine Learning and Artificial Intelligence
It are closely connected, but they are not exactly the same. Artificial Intelligence is a broader
concept focused on creating systems that can perform tasks associated with human
intelligence. Machine Learning is one of the important technologies used to achieve this goal.

Challenges and Limitations
Although it offers many advantages, it also comes with challenges. It systems depend heavily
on the quality of their training data. Incorrect, incomplete, or biased information can result in
inaccurate or unfair outcomes.
Privacy is another important concern. Many intelligent systems process large amounts of
personal or behavioral data, making responsible data management essential. Security,
transparency, accountability, and ethical use must also be considered when developing
machine learning applications.
